Position Summary
The Maintenance Technician will be responsible for maintaining, repairing, and renovating residential properties. This position requires a strong technical skillset, the ability to manage projects independently, and a commitment to delivering excellent service to residents and the property management team.
Key Responsibilities
- Respond to, diagnose, and resolve all maintenance tickets in a timely manner.
- Perform necessary maintenance and repairs at apartments and rental homes (HVAC, plumbing, electrical, carpentry, painting, and appliance repair).
- Perform and oversee renovation and construction projects for units being prepared for resale.
- Conduct unit turns, including cleaning, painting, flooring, fixture replacement, and general repairs.
- Order and track all necessary materials for maintenance and renovation work.
- Handle after-hours maintenance emergencies on a rotating on-call schedule.
- Obtain, review, and recommend bids for outsourced jobs requiring third-party contractors.
- Perform routine property inspections and preventative maintenance.
- Ensure all work is performed in compliance with safety standards, codes, and company policies.
- Assist tenants as needed with trash removal.
Qualifications
- 3+ years of property maintenance experience, preferably in multifamily or apartment communities.
- Strong knowledge of HVAC, plumbing, electrical, and carpentry systems.
- Hands-on renovation and unit-turn experience.
- Ability to read blueprints, work orders, and technical manuals.
- Strong organizational and communication skills.
- Valid driver’s license and reliable transportation required.
- Must be able to lift 50 lbs. and perform physical labor as needed.
- EPA HVAC certification preferred (but not required).
- Ability to work independently and handle multiple projects simultaneously.
